The Antihypertensive Reduces Vascular Risk?

 Antihypertensive

What is the most antihypertensive therapy protects the cardiovascular and cerebrovascular system? Have talked about names in cardiology authoritative speakers at the symposium “Optimizing to hypertensive therapy reduces cardiovascular and cerebrovascular risks” of the ESC Congress 2005 which was held in Stockholm.

The antihypertensive reduces vascular risk?

Once again in this authoritative occasion was highlighted as the main goal of treatment of hypertensive disease should not be considered the sole reduction of blood pressure to reach the target values recommended by recent guidelines, but a significant decrease risk of vascular disease of the heart, brain and related systems.

Although the last major international trials have however shown a significant reduction of vascular risk in correlation to a reduction in blood pressure in hypertensive patients, Bryan Williams, professor at the University of Leicester, in the first speech of the symposium, it was initially asked whether all types of medication available today are just as effective, not only in reducing blood pressure, but also in the entity of the reduction in cardiovascular and cerebrovascular risk.

Is it possible that some groups of drugs are able to reduce the risk more significantly than others, despite equally effective in controlling blood pressure, thanks to ancillary benefits that accompany the principal action of certain substances (eg , activity on endothelial function, renal protection, control of values and anti-inflammatory efficacy of lipemia). But this is currently only a hypothesis can not yet proven. More plausible is instead the possibility that some antihypertensive drugs (such as blockers of the renin-angiotensin system), or some combination of therapeutic classes, are able to delay the onset of diabetes mellitus or to obtain more evidence of harm reduction ’s body linked to high blood pressure or prevent it from developing as it has been demonstrated on left ventricular hypertrophy
